Transaction 598bcb8ac85a2e58d8bc5c6679496667c4f6e9f81ff7c4b03b747f800f5ae239

block
cae737f1a9723f4386ffd990aa329c10f0c970ea0bd1705c871178aeef5cf33c

1 Input

143 Outputs